深入探究,Redis Incrby 原子性的保障秘诀
Redis 的 Incrby 操作在很多应用场景中发挥着关键作用,而其原子性的保障更是备受关注。
Redis Incrby 之所以能够保证原子性,是基于其内部精妙的设计和实现机制,Redis 是一个单线程的内存数据库,这意味着在同一时刻只有一个操作能够被执行,当执行 Incrby 操作时,不会出现并发冲突导致的数据不一致问题。

Redis 在处理 Incrby 操作时,会将整个操作视为一个不可分割的单元,这就如同一个完整的任务,要么全部完成,要么完全不做,不会出现只完成一部分的情况。
Redis 还采用了一些优化策略来确保 Incrby 操作的高效和稳定,它会合理利用内存,避免不必要的资源消耗,从而提高操作的性能和原子性保障的可靠性。
在实际应用中,为了更好地利用 Redis Incrby 的原子性特性,开发者需要合理规划数据结构和操作流程,要充分考虑业务需求和数据特点,避免出现过度依赖或者错误使用的情况。
深入理解 Redis Incrby 原子性的保障原理和机制,对于开发者优化系统性能、提高数据处理的准确性和可靠性具有重要意义。
参考来源:Redis 官方文档及相关技术论坛。